Norfolk to Rome by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Norfolk to Rome by plane will take about 15h 26m and departs from Norfolk International Airport (ORF) and arrives into Rome–Fiumicino Leonardo da Vinci International Airport (FCO). There are flights departing 2-4 times a week on this route. American Airlines is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ing 2-4 times a week.

Norfolk to Rome by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Norfolk to Rome by ship will take about 23 days 17h and departs from Norfolk (USORF) and arrives into Salerno (ITSAL). There are vessels departing 1-2 times a week on this route. COSCO is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ing 1-2 times a week.
